位置:学校首页 > 学校动态>的孩子能直接学C++吗衡水童程童美大揭秘
的孩子能直接学C++吗衡水童程童美大揭秘,,C++,是目前所有编程语言中生命力较强的。它比Python发明早得多,越早的编程语言越难学,越晚的编程语言越容易学会。通常用Python写一个小的功能,可能只需要几行代码。但如果用C++去写,可能得写5倍到10倍的代码才能够实现相同的功能。
C++是一门并不简单的编程语言,它和数学的关系密切,几乎所有的选手的数学成绩都比较。
它需要学习组合数学、图论、基本算法、数据结构、搜索算法及数学建模等知识,所以很多信奥赛选手都早早就做好了规划。
C++是一门并不简单的编程语言,它和数学的关系密切,几乎所有的选手的数学成绩都比较。它需要学习组合数学、图论、基本算法、数据结构、搜索算法及数学建模等知识,所以很多信奥赛选手都早早就做好了规划。
综合来说,Scratch承担了孩子的编程启蒙重任,Python是目前较合适孩子的信息技术学习工具,C++难度较大且是信息学竞赛的指定语言。
学习Scratch、Python和C++一般有以下两条路:
一、从入门到高阶,从难易度和年龄上来说,适合绝大多数孩子的学习路径是这样的:
Scratch → Python → C++
学习建议
一~:学Scratch启蒙入门。
:孩子在3年级时,可以考虑花上一年到一年半的时间,先学Python。同时,还可以让孩子参加含金量高的科创活动,包括白名单赛事蓝桥杯和NOC等。
~:学习能力、抗挫能力、数学知识的积累等,都到了能学C++的阶段了,可以规划孩子转到C++的学习,较后参加信息学奥赛,这样可以过渡得比较平缓。
二、如果孩子有天赋、基础好,从3年级开始直接学C++。但注意较晚从初中开始学,因为高中时间很紧迫了。
从很多选手案例来看,直接学习C++的选手凤毛麟角,只占少数,即便是拿到的选手往往也都是学习过其他编程语言后才专攻C++的,更多的孩子都是小时候有了一定基础认知之后才开始学的。